牛瓜氨酸血症、尿苷酸合酶缺乏症PCR-RFLP检测方法的建立及应用  被引量:5

Development and application of PCR-RFLP for detecting bovine citrullinemia and deficiency of uridine monophophate synthase

摘  要:为了解我国奶牛群中牛瓜氨酸血症(Citrullinemia,CN)、尿苷酸合酶缺乏症(Deficiency of uridine monophophate synthase,DUMPS)的携带和发生情况,根据已报道的ASS、UMPS基因核苷酸序列,设计2对引物建立了相应PCR-RFLP检测方法,并对表型正常的436头荷斯坦母牛及93头荷斯坦公牛进行检测。结果共检出CN、DUMPS杂合牛分别为8和6头,携带率分别为1.55%,1.17%,其中CN、DUMPS公牛杂合子分别为2和1头。Bovine citrullinemia (CN) and deficiency of uridine monophophate synthase (DUMPS) are bovine inherited metabolic diseases caused by autosomal recessive disorder. The genic mutations of argininosuccinate synthetase gene and uridine monophophate synthase gene are responsible for CN,DUMPS, respectively. In order to detect the carrier of CN and DUMPS in Holstein cattle in China,436 cows and 93 bulls from Sbandong province were investigated by PCR-RFLP. Results showed that 8,6 cattles were CN carriers,DUMPS carriers, respectively. Indicating that the proportion of CN,DUMPS carrier in the tested cattles were 1.55 % and 1.17 %,respectively.
